Normal coloring worksheets activities for Grade 2 are an essential educational tool that foster a wide range of developmental benefits in young learners. These worksheets are specifically designed to cater to the educational and developmental needs of second-grade students, providing a perfect blend of learning and fun. Here's why these coloring activities are invaluable:
Enhances Fine Motor Skills: Coloring requires children to use their hands in specific ways. This action helps in the development of muscle strength, control, and dexterity which are essential for writing and other school activities.
Promotes Concentration and Focus: Engaging in normal coloring worksheets activities demands a certain level of attention. Grade 2 students learn to focus on completing a task, which is a crucial skill for academic success.
Boosts Creativity and Self-expression: Coloring allows children to express themselves creatively. They learn to communicate their feelings, ideas, and thoughts through colors and artwork. This expressive outlet is vital for emotional development and fosters a sense of individuality.
Encourages Color Recognition and Usage: Through these activities, children become familiar with different colors and how to use them effectively. They learn about color combinations and how colors can be used to represent different moods, objects, or scenes.
Improves Hand-Eye Coordination: The act of coloring within the lines improves hand-eye coordination. Children learn to see where their hand movements are leading and adjust accordingly, which is beneficial for other academic and non-academic activities.
Provides Learning Opportunities: Normal coloring worksheets for Grade 2 often include educational themes, such as numbers, letters, animals, and nature. This makes learning more enjoyable and interactive, as children can color while absorbing new information.
In conclusion, normal coloring worksheets activities for Grade 2 are much more than just a pastime. They are a multifaceted educational tool that supports the holistic development of young learners, making them a crucial part of early childhood education.
